When looking closely at the panamera review 2026 updates, the standout feature is the Porsche Active Ride suspension system.

This advanced electrohydraulic setup completely abandons traditional anti-roll bars. Instead, it uses sophisticated hydraulic pumps at each wheel to actively combat body movements. As a result, the vehicle keeps itself completely flat when accelerating, cornering hard, or stopping abruptly. Furthermore, it lifts the body slightly when you open the door. This thoughtful feature makes it much easier to climb inside the driver-focused cockpit.

Beyond the magical suspension system, this flagship model receives an updated battery pack. The usable energy storage capacity grows significantly to 25.9 kWh. Therefore, owners can enjoy much longer purely electric driving stints before the internal combustion components wake up.

Powertrain Dynamics: The Insane Panamera Hybrid Setup

The sheer mechanical complexity hiding under the aluminum skin of this panamera hybrid is nothing short of breathtaking. Specifically, Porsche pairs a revised 4.0-liter twin-turbocharged V8 engine with an upgraded electric motor. This motor is integrated directly inside the casing of the rapid 8-speed dual-clutch transmission.

When you mash your foot down on the accelerator, the immediate torque from the electric system fills the turbo lag. Then, the twin turbochargers build pressure instantly. The ensuing launch pins your body directly into the leather sport seats with terrifying force. Power travels across all four wheels through an intelligent all-wheel-drive system.

  • Brutal Acceleration: The vehicle rockets from 0 to 60 mph in an estimated 2.8 seconds using standard launch control.

  • Top Speed: This absolute beast keeps pushing forward until it hits an estimated top track speed of 202 mph.

  • Pure EV Mode: Drivers can cruise silently using purely electric energy at highway speeds up to 87 mph.

Detailed Specifications and Performance Data

The raw numbers behind this porsche super sedan highlight how far engineers can push modern hybrid technology.

The following data table outlines the official panamera turbo s specs for the current model year based on available manufacturer documentation:

Performance MetricEngineering Specification Value
Combustion Engine Base4.0-Liter Twin-Turbocharged V8
Integrated Electric Motor OutputEstimated 187 Horsepower
Combined Maximum System Output771 Total Horsepower
Combined Peak System Torque737 Pound-Feet
High-Voltage Traction Battery Capacity25.9 kWh Total
Estimated All-Electric Driving RangeUp to 40 Miles Per Charge
Standard Factory Braking Hardware10-Piston Front Ceramic Composite Calipers

Note: Performance and driving range metrics represent estimated laboratory testing figures provided by the manufacturer based on standard conditions.

The Dynamic Ride: Defying Physics on Winding Roads

Driving a vehicle this heavy should feel sluggish, yet this panamera turbo s 2026 entry maneuvers like a light sports car. The rear-axle steering system shrinks the physical wheelbase during tight maneuvers. Therefore, the large four-door frame slices through sharp corners with shocking agility.

If you put the vehicle into its aggressive Sport Plus mode, the active exhaust valves open fully. Consequently, the V8 engine sings a deep bass note. The steering wheel delivers an incredible amount of communication, transmitting grip levels directly to the driver’s hands.

Interior Luxury and High-Tech Screen Layouts

The cabin design takes inspiration from the all-electric Taycan, giving the driver a clean digital layout called the Porsche Driver Experience. A curved 12.6-inch digital gauge cluster sits right in front of the steering wheel. This display offers several customizable views including classic analog-style dials.

The central dashboard houses a fast 10.9-inch touchscreen infotainment display running the latest operating system. Additionally, buyers can option an extra screen directly in front of the passenger seat. This setup allows them to stream media or view performance metrics without distracting the driver.

  • Craftsmanship: Beautiful Race-Tex suede textures and premium leathers wrap around nearly every visible cabin surface.

  • Design Accents: The cabin features exclusive Turbonite grey metallic details reserved purely for top-tier models.

  • Storage Space: The functional rear hatchback design opens up wide, offering great utility that traditional sedans cannot match.

Real-World Usability and Charging Efficiency

Living with a high-performance panamera hybrid is remarkably easy thanks to standard modern charging hardware. The vehicle features an 11-kW onboard charger. This unit can fully replenish the battery in roughly three hours when plugged into a home charging station.

While the theoretical fuel economy numbers from official testing look incredibly high, your actual consumption depends on charging habits. On short daily commutes around town, you may rarely burn a single drop of gasoline. However, on long cross-country road trips with a depleted battery, the V8 powertrain delivers a realistic figure around 25 mpg.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is the estimated price of the panamera turbo s 2026 model?

The flagship model sits at the top of the lineup, featuring an estimated base retail price starting around $245,200 before options.

How many miles of pure electric range does the panamera hybrid offer?

Thanks to the larger battery pack, the vehicle is estimated to achieve up to 40 miles of pure electric driving on a charge.

What is the exact 0 to 60 time listed in the panamera turbo s specs?

When utilizing the standard launch control system, the vehicle completes the 0 to 60 mph sprint in a blistering 2.8 seconds.

How does the active ride suspension work on this porsche super sedan?

The system utilizes independent electrohydraulic motor-pump units at each wheel. This allows the car to instantly push back against cornering forces, keeping the cabin perfectly flat.
